AI Technical Summary
When users communicate through translation devices, they need to frequently pass the devices around, resulting in low communication convenience and efficiency, and failing to meet the distance requirements of business etiquette and social etiquette.
A translation system is used, including a translation device and at least two portable sound pickup and playback devices, which realizes real-time translation and playback of voice data through Bluetooth connection. Users use personal devices to collect and play voice, avoiding device transmission.
It improves the convenience and efficiency of communication, meets the distance requirements of business etiquette and social etiquette, reduces the trouble of equipment delivery, avoids hygiene problems, and supports users to move freely within a larger range.

TECHNICAL FIELD
[0001] The present application relates to the technical field of computer, in particular to a translation method and a translation system. BACKGROUND
[0002] At present, in the scenario that users need to communicate through translation, both parties need to share a translation device. If a user needs to speak, the user takes the translation device and speaks a language to the microphone in the translation device, so that the microphone in the translation device collects the voice data of the language, and then the translation device translates the voice data into voice data of another language, and then plays the voice data of the another language for another user to listen to and understand the meaning.
[0003] However, in the above scheme, the translation device needs to be frequently passed between the two parties during communication, which is low in communication convenience and efficiency. SUMMARY
[0004] The present application shows a translation method and a translation system.
[0005] In a first aspect, the present application shows a translation method applied to a translation system, the translation system comprising: a translation device and at least two portable sound pickup and playback devices; the translation device and each portable sound pickup and playback device have a Bluetooth connection therebetween;
[0006] The translation method comprises:
[0007] A first portable sound pickup and playback device of the at least two portable sound pickup and playback devices collects voice data of a first language spoken by a first user; the first portable sound pickup and playback device is one of the at least two portable sound pickup and playback devices;
[0008] The first portable sound pickup and playback device sends the voice data of the first language to the translation device through a first Bluetooth connection between the first portable sound pickup and playback device and the translation device;
[0009] The translation device receives the voice data of the first language through the first Bluetooth connection;
[0010] The translation device translates the voice data of the first language into voice data of a second language, the second language being a language selected in advance by a second user using a second portable sound pickup and playback device in the translation device; the second portable sound pickup and playback device is a portable sound pickup and playback device other than the first portable sound pickup and playback device among the at least two portable sound pickup and playback devices;
[0011] The translation device sends the voice data in the second language to the second portable sound pickup and playback device via a second Bluetooth connection between the translation device and the second portable sound pickup and playback device;
[0012] The second portable sound pickup and playback device receives the voice data in the second language via the second Bluetooth connection;
[0013] The second portable sound pickup and playback device plays the voice data in the second language.

[0074] Referring to Figure 2 , a step flowchart of a translation method of the present application is shown, which can be applied to Figure 1 , wherein the method can specifically include the following steps:
[0075] In step S101, a first portable sound pickup and playing device of at least two portable sound pickup and playing devices collects voice data of a first language spoken by a first user. The first portable sound pickup and playing device is one of the at least two portable sound pickup and playing devices.
[0076] The first user is a user using the first portable sound pickup and playing device.
[0077] In the present application, one user can use one portable sound pickup and playing device, and one user corresponds to one portable sound pickup and playing device in a one-to-one manner, and different users use different portable sound pickup and playing devices.
[0078] In the present application, the first user masters the first language and does not master the second language, that is, the first user can speak and understand the first language, but cannot speak and understand the second language.
[0079] The second user masters the second language and does not master the first language, that is, the second user can speak and understand the second language, but cannot speak and understand the first language.
[0080] Therefore, in the case of conversation between the first user and the second user or in the case of being in the same meeting and the like, it is necessary to communicate through translation so that the first user and the second user can understand the voice (meaning expressed) spoken by each other.
[0081] In the case where the first user needs to speak to the second user, the first user can speak voice data of the first language to the first portable sound pickup and playing device used by the first user (held by the first user, attached to the chest of the first user or attached to the collar of the clothes of the first user). Then the first portable sound pickup and playing device collects voice data of the first language spoken by the first user.
[0082] In the present application, sometimes, in the scenario that the first user is in conversation with the second user or is located in the same conference and needs to communicate, it is not the case that all the words spoken by the first user need to be translated for the second user to listen to, in this case, in order to avoid translating the voice data spoken by the first user which does not need to be translated for the second user to listen to, the first user can actively control the first portable sound pickup and playing device, for example, in the present application, in the case that the first user needs the translation device to translate the voice data in the first language spoken by the first user for the second user to listen to, the first user can actively control the first portable sound pickup and playing device to collect the voice data in the first language spoken by the first user.
[0083] For example, in an embodiment of the present application, the first portable sound pickup and playing device has a collection button, which can be a physical button.
[0084] In the case that the first user needs the translation device to translate the voice data in the first language spoken by the first user for the second user to listen to, the first user needs to control the first portable sound pickup and playing device to collect the voice data in the first language spoken by the first user, thus, the first user can press the collection button on the first portable sound pickup and playing device. In the case that the collection button on the first portable sound pickup and playing device is pressed, the first portable sound pickup and playing device collects the voice data in the first language spoken by the first user.
[0085] In one example, the first user can press the collection button on the first portable sound pickup and playing device and then release the collection button, the collection button being pressed once can serve as the trigger condition for the first portable sound pickup and playing device to collect the voice data in the first language spoken by the first user, and subsequently, the first portable sound pickup and playing device always collects the voice data in the first language spoken by the first user until the first user stops speaking (stops speaking voice), that is, until the first portable sound pickup and playing device can no longer detect the voice data in the first language spoken by the first user, and stops collecting.
[0086] Or, in another example, the first user can continuously press the collection button on the first portable sound pickup and playing device and does not release the collection button, the collection button being pressed serves as the trigger condition for the first portable sound pickup and playing device to collect the voice data in the first language spoken by the first user, and subsequently, in the process of continuously pressing the collection button, the first portable sound pickup and playing device always collects the voice data in the first language spoken by the first user until the first user releases the collection button, and stops collecting.
[0087] For example, in one embodiment of the present application, the first portable sound-picking and playing device is configured to set a user as the exclusive user of the first portable sound-picking and playing device, and the first portable sound-picking and playing device is configured to collect voice data of the exclusive user of the first portable sound-picking and playing device, and the first portable sound-picking and playing device is configured to not collect voice data of other users.
[0088] For example, the first portable sound-picking and playing device is provided with a setting button, and if the first user needs to set the first user as the exclusive user of the first portable sound-picking and playing device, the first user can press the setting button of the first portable sound-picking and playing device, and in the process of pressing the setting button of the first portable sound-picking and playing device, the first user can speak, the first portable sound-picking and playing device collects voice data of the first user, performs voiceprint analysis on the voice data of the first user, obtains voiceprint features of the first user, and stores the voiceprint features of the first user in the first portable sound-picking and playing device, thereby setting the first user as the exclusive user of the first portable sound-picking and playing device.
[0089] Therefore, in the case that the first user is the exclusive user of the first portable sound-picking and playing device, the first portable sound-picking and playing device collects voice data of the first user in the first language.
[0090] For example, after the first portable sound-picking and playing device starts to collect voice data of the first user in the first language, the first portable sound-picking and playing device performs voiceprint analysis on the voice data of the first user in the first language, obtains voiceprint features of the first user, compares the voiceprint features of the first user with the stored voiceprint features of the exclusive user, and if the voiceprint features of the first user are consistent with the stored voiceprint features of the exclusive user, it is determined that the first user is the exclusive user of the first portable sound-picking and playing device, and the first portable sound-picking and playing device continues to collect voice data of the first user in the first language.
[0091] For example, in another embodiment of the present application, it is found through statistics that in the scenario in which a user needs to speak voice data for the first portable sound-picking and playing device to collect, the user often holds the microphone of the first portable sound-picking and playing device vertically upward, and then speaks, and therefore, in the case that the posture of the first portable sound-picking and playing device is changed to a preset posture, it is determined that the first user may have spoken voice data in the first language that needs to be translated, and thus the first portable sound-picking and playing device collects voice data of the first user in the first language.
[0092] The preset posture includes a posture in which the microphone of the first portable sound-picking and playing device is held vertically upward, etc.
[0093] For another example, in another embodiment of the present application, the inventors discovered that not every time a user points the microphone of the first portable sound pickup and playback device vertically upward does they necessarily need to speak. Sometimes, this may be a subconscious action or other action rather than a need to speak. However, statistically, it has been found that when a user needs to speak, the speech often lasts for a long time, for example, for multiple seconds. This causes the microphone of the first portable sound pickup and playback device to remain vertically upward for a long time. Therefore, if the first portable sound pickup and playback device remains in a preset posture for longer than a preset time, it indicates that the first user may have sent voice data in the first language that requires double translation. In this case, the first portable sound pickup and playback device collects the voice data in the first language sent by the first user. The preset time may include 1 second, 2 seconds, 3 seconds, or 4 seconds, etc., and this application does not limit this.

[0108] In the present application, an indicator light is arranged on each portable sound-picking and playing device.
[0109] For example, the color of the indicator light after being turned on can be green, or the color of the indicator light after being turned on can be red.
[0110] In another embodiment of the present application, the method further comprises:
[0111] During the process in which the second portable sound-picking and playing device is playing the voice data in the second language, the second portable sound-picking and playing device controls the indicator light on the second portable sound-picking and playing device to be always on; the always-on indicator light is used to indicate that the second portable sound-picking and playing device is in a state in which voice data cannot be collected (that is, when the indicator light on the second portable sound-picking and playing device is always on, the second portable sound-picking and playing device does not collect the voice data issued by the second user). Always on can be understood as continuously turning on.
[0112] The second user using the second portable sound-pickup and playing device can perceive that the second portable sound-pickup and playing device is in a state of being unable to collect voice data after seeing that the indicator light on the second portable sound-pickup and playing device is always on, that is, the second portable sound-pickup and playing device does not collect voice data of the second user at this time, even if the second user speaks, the second portable sound-pickup and playing device will not collect voice data of the second user, and the second portable sound-pickup and playing device is playing voice data of the second language at this time. In this way, the second user can not speak the second language at this time, that is, not speak, so as to realize the purpose of prompting the second user not to speak at this time, so as to enable the second user to hear the voice data of the second language played by the second portable sound-pickup and playing device as clearly as possible, and avoid affecting the communication between the first user and the second user.
[0113] However, after the indicator light on the second portable sound-pickup and playing device is always on, the second user still speaks sometimes, for example, the second user does not notice the always-on indicator light on the second portable sound-pickup and playing device.
[0114] Therefore, in order to enable the second user to hear the voice data of the second language played by the second portable sound-pickup and playing device as clearly as possible, and avoid affecting the communication between the first user and the second user, the second user can be enabled to know that he / she should try not to speak at this time as much as possible. In another embodiment of the present application, after the indicator light on the second portable sound-pickup and playing device is always on, the second portable sound-pickup and playing device controls the indicator light on the second portable sound-pickup and playing device to flash when the second portable sound-pickup and playing device detects that the second user using the second portable sound-pickup and playing device speaks; that is, the indicator light on the second portable sound-pickup and playing device changes from the always-on state to the flashing state.
[0115] Compared with the always-on indicator light, the flashing indicator light is a strong prompt, which improves the possibility that the second user can notice the flashing indicator light, and further improves the possibility that the second user can know that he / she should try not to speak at this time, so as to enable the second user to not speak at this time as much as possible, enable the second user to hear the voice data of the second language played by the second portable sound-pickup and playing device as clearly as possible, and avoid affecting the communication between the first user and the second user as much as possible.
[0116] Further, in a case that the second portable sound-picking and playing device detects that the second user using the second portable sound-picking and playing device does not speak (for example, does not speak for 1 second, 1.5 seconds or 2 seconds), the second portable sound-picking and playing device controls the indicator light on the second portable sound-picking and playing device to be always on, that is, the indicator light on the second portable sound-picking and playing device is changed from blinking to always-on state. In this way, in a case that the second user does not speak, the life of the indicator light is avoided from being affected by too many times of blinking, and the second portable sound-picking and playing device is avoided from consuming too much electric energy due to too many times of blinking.
[0117] Alternatively, in another embodiment of the present application, the second portable sound-picking and playing device is internally provided with a vibrator. After the indicator light on the second portable sound-picking and playing device is always on, in a case that the second portable sound-picking and playing device detects that the second user using the second portable sound-picking and playing device speaks, the second portable sound-picking and playing device controls the vibrator in the second portable sound-picking and playing device to vibrate.
[0118] Compared with the indicator light being always on, the vibrator vibrating is a strong prompt, which improves the possibility that the second user can notice the blinking of the second indicator light, and further improves the possibility that the second user can know that he / she needs to try not to speak at this time, so as to make the second user not speak at this time as much as possible, make the second user listen to the voice data in the second language played by the second portable sound-picking and playing device as much as possible, and avoid affecting the communication between the first user and the second user as much as possible.
[0119] Further, in a case that the second portable sound-picking and playing device detects that the second user using the second portable sound-picking and playing device does not speak (for example, does not speak for 1 second, 1.5 seconds or 2 seconds), the second portable sound-picking and playing device controls the vibrator in the second portable sound-picking and playing device to stop vibrating. In this way, in a case that the second user does not speak, the second portable sound-picking and playing device is avoided from consuming too much electric energy due to the vibrator.
[0120] Further, in another embodiment of the present application, the method further comprises:
[0121] After the second portable sound-picking and playing device finishes playing the voice data in the second language, the second portable sound-picking and playing device controls the indicator light on the second portable sound-picking and playing device to be turned off; the turned-off indicator light is used to indicate that the second portable sound-picking and playing device is in a state capable of collecting voice data (afterwards, the second portable sound-picking and playing device can collect the voice data spoken by the second user).
[0122] The second user can see the indicator light on the second portable sound-picking and playing device turn off, and can perceive that the second portable sound-picking and playing device is in a state capable of collecting voice data, i.e., the second portable sound-picking and playing device is capable of collecting voice data.
[0123] After the second user using the second portable sound-picking and playing device sees the indicator light on the second portable sound-picking and playing device turn off, the second user can perceive that the second portable sound-picking and playing device is in a state capable of collecting voice data at this moment, and the second portable sound-picking and playing device is not playing voice data, so there is no problem of whether the second user can clearly hear the voice data played by the second portable sound-picking and playing device, and thus the second user can send voice data in the second language for the second portable sound-picking and playing device to collect.
[0124] In another embodiment of the present application, the second portable sound-picking and playing device is internally provided with a replay button.
[0125] For example, in the scenario that the second portable sound-picking and playing device plays voice data in the second language for the first time, the second user does not clearly hear the voice data in the second language played by the second portable sound-picking and playing device, and cannot understand the meaning of the voice data in the second language.
[0126] Therefore, in order to enable the second user to clearly hear the voice data in the second language played by the second portable sound-picking and playing device, and further understand the meaning of the voice data in the second language, the second user can control the second portable sound-picking and playing device to play the voice data in the second language again from the first voice frame of the voice data in the second language by means of the replay button.
[0127] For example, the second user can input a short press operation on the replay button, and the short press operation includes a single click operation on the replay button, or the short press operation includes a press operation on the replay button with a press duration less than 0.6 seconds or 0.7 seconds.
[0128] Therefore, the translation method further comprises: during the process that the second portable sound-picking and playing device plays the voice data in the second language, or after the second portable sound-picking and playing device finishes playing the voice data in the second language, if the second portable sound-picking and playing device receives a short press operation on the replay button, the second portable sound-picking and playing device plays the voice data in the second language again from the first voice frame of the voice data in the second language.
[0129] In the present application, sometimes the voice data in the second language is very long (10-second voice, 15-second voice, or 20-second voice, etc.), so the duration of the second portable sound-picking and playing device playing the voice data in the second language completely is very long (for example, 10 seconds, 15 seconds, or 20 seconds, etc.).
[0130] However, the content that the second user needs to focus on may be the front part of the voice data in the second language, and the back part of the voice data in the second language may not be the content that the user needs to focus on.
[0131] Alternatively, the content that the second user did not hear clearly may be the first part of the voice data in the second language, and the second part of the voice data in the second language may be the content that the user has heard clearly.
[0132] In this case, the user mainly wants to listen to the first part of the second language voice data again, and may not want to listen to the last part of the second language voice data again to avoid wasting time.
[0133] In this case, after the second portable sound pickup and playback device starts playing the second language voice data again, starting from the first frame of the second language voice data, if the first portion of the second language voice data has already been played, then after the user has clearly heard and understood the content of the first portion of the second language voice data, there is no need to continue playing the subsequent portion of the second language voice data. Moreover, while the second portable sound pickup and playback device is playing the voice data (whether it is the first playback or repeated playback), neither the first portable sound pickup and playback device nor the second portable sound pickup and playback device can collect voice data.
[0134] To this end, accordingly, in order to save time and improve the efficiency of communication between the first user and the second user, if the user has clearly heard and understood the content of the first part of the voice data in the second language, the user can control the second portable sound pickup and playback device to stop playing the voice data in the second language. In this way, the first portable sound pickup and playback device or the second portable sound pickup and playback device can collect voice data, which facilitates communication between the first user and the second user.
[0135] To this end, in another embodiment of the present application, a stop playback button is built into the second portable sound pickup and playback device.
[0136] Thus, the translation method further includes: during the process of the second portable sound pickup and playback device replaying the voice data of the second language, if the second portable sound pickup and playback device receives a pressing operation on the stop playback button, the second portable sound pickup and playback device stops playing the voice data of the second language.
[0137] Alternatively, in another embodiment of the present application, the translation method further comprises: during the process that the second portable sound-picking and playing device replays the voice data in the second language, if the second portable sound-picking and playing device receives a long-press operation on the replay button, the second portable sound-picking and playing device stops playing the voice data in the second language. In this embodiment, the second portable sound-picking and playing device can not be built-in with a stop playing button, thus, the physical cost can be saved.
[0138] The long-press operation comprises a press operation with a duration of more than 1 second or 1.1 second.
[0139] Further, after the second portable sound-picking and playing device stops playing the voice data in the second language, the second user can not have clearly heard the content of the front part of the voice data in the second language, therefore, the second user can control the second portable sound-picking and playing device to not continue playing the content of the rear part of the voice data in the second language, but to replay the content of the front part of the voice data in the second language again. For example, the second user can input a short-press operation on the replay button, the short-press operation comprises a single-click operation on the replay button, or the short-press operation comprises a press operation with a duration of less than 0.6 second or 0.7 second.
[0140] If the second portable sound-picking and playing device receives the short-press operation on the replay button, the second portable sound-picking and playing device replays the voice data in the second language from the first voice frame of the voice data in the second language, which facilitates the second user to listen to the voice data in the second language again, for example, the second user can immediately listen to the content of the front part of the voice data in the second language again without listening to the content of the rear part of the voice data in the second language played last time, so as to save time and improve efficiency.
